Official Arduino Portenta C33 Development Board
The Official Arduino Portenta C33 is a powerful System-on-Module (SoM) designed for cost-effective Internet of Things (IoT) applications. Powered by the R7FA6M5BH2CBG microcontroller from Renesas, this Arduino module is engineered to offer impressive performance for a variety of IoT projects while maintaining an affordable price point.
Sharing the same form factor as the Portenta H7, the Portenta C33 is fully compatible with all Portenta family shields and carriers through its high-density connectors. This backward compatibility ensures seamless integration into existing Portenta ecosystems.
With its robust processing capabilities and versatile connectivity options, the Arduino Portenta C33 board is an ideal solution for developers seeking to create smart home devices, connected industrial sensors, and other IoT applications on a budget.

Features:
- Low-Cost IoT Applications: Designed for budget-friendly IoT projects, offering Wi-Fi/Bluetooth LE connectivity.
- High-Level Programming Support: Compatible with MicroPython and other high-level programming languages for flexible development.
- Industrial-Grade Security: Built-in hardware-level security and secure OTA firmware updates for reliable and secure deployments.
- Ready-to-Use Software Libraries: Access to pre-built software libraries and Arduino sketches for quick and easy development.
- Real-Time Data Monitoring: Seamless integration with Arduino IoT Cloud for real-time data monitoring and display on widget-based dashboards.
- Compatibility with Arduino Families: Fully compatible with both Arduino Portenta and MKR families, offering a versatile solution.
- Castellated Pins for Automation: Features castellated pins, enabling efficient use in automatic assembly lines.
1. How to set up the Arduino Portenta C33 Development Board?
You should connect the Arduino Portenta C33 to your computer via USB-C and open the Arduino IDE. Install the Portenta core from the Board Manager, select the correct board and port, and upload a test sketch to verify the setup. This process ensures your development environment is properly configured for programming.

4. How to power the Arduino Portenta C33 Development Board?
The board can be powered through USB-C, Li-Po battery, or an external DC source. Its built-in power management ensures stable operation for portable and industrial applications. The versatile power options support deployment in various environments and use cases.
